In short, my understanding is that Aachen (and presumably others who have withdrawn) want only to invite pairs that are highly qualified (ranking on the FEI rider chart) vs the new FEI invitation rules which state that every national federation must be invited with no exclusions.

Aachen in withdrawing from the Nations’ Cup also gives itself the room to refuse to invite riders who aren’t “in good standing” (my speculation is in situations like when Russian athletes were disinvited from international competition due to Current Events).

Basically, FEI wants to make it a “everyone gets an invitation!” but Aachen and others are saying “no, we only want to invite the best.”
